Subject: [MDBirding] DC - West Potomac Park to Hain's Point (11-28)


Chris Tonra, Tim Guida, and I did a quick lunch run along the Potomac River in DC. All of the Horned Grebes and the Long-tailed Duck reported yesterday seemingly vacated the area overnight and the river was very quiet overall. The following were some highlights (nearly all waterfowl were southeast off of the tip of Hain's Point):

Lesser Scaup - 220
Bufflehead - 5
Red-breasted Merganser - 1
Ruddy Duck - 1
Pied-billed Grebe - 5 (Tidal Basin)
Merlin - 1 (perched and hunting at the point)
